Product
Antenna, Loop
EM-6879 | 10 KHz – 30 MHz
-
The EM-6879 Loop Antenna is used for magnetic field measurements over the frequency range of 10 kHz to 30 MHz. The EM-6879 is designed for use with any 50 ohm Receiver System. The antenna has a balanced Faraday shield that reduces its response to electric fields to a vanishingly small amount so that it can produce a practically pure magnetic field response.

Product
Electron Multiplication (EM) Standard Image Sensors
-
EM (Electron Multiplication) is a technology that uses on-chip gain in the charge domain to effectively eliminate read noise from an image sensor. This enables advanced ultra-low light applications that require extreme sensitivity at fast frame rates. Examples include life science applications such as single molecule detection, super resolution microscopy and spinning disk confocal microscopy along with physical science applications such as nanotechnology imaging, Bose Einstein condensates and soft X-ray spectroscopy, and astronomy applications such as adaptive optics and lucky imaging. The inclusion of an additional conventional output allows further flexibility for applications such as true 24 hour surveillance.

Product
Transmissive Optical Encoder Module
EM1
-
The EM1 is a transmissive optical encoder module designed to be an improved replacement for the Avago HEDS-9000 series encoder module. This module is designed to detect rotary or linear position when used together with a code wheel or linear strip. The EM1 consists of a lensed LED source and a monolithic detector IC enclosed in a small polymer package. The EM1 uses phased array detector technology to provide superior performance and greater tolerances over traditional aperture mask type encoders.
